SICILY. Syracuse. Pyrrhos (Circa 278-276 BC). Ae Litra.

Obv: ΣΥΡΑΚΟΣΙΩΝ.
Head of Herakles left, wearing lion skin; club behind.
Rev: Athena advancing right, holding spear and shield; wreath to left.

CNS 177 Ds69 Rs42; HGC 2, 1450.

Condition: Good very fine.

Weight: 9.49 g.
Diameter: 24 mm.
